Liverpool boss willing to bring in Berahino for £15million


West Brom being desperate to hold on to their key goal scorer they might also be tempted to let him go for a huge amount.

Liverpool Boss Brendan Rodgers wants Saido Berahino to solve his goalscoring problems in January.
The Reds boss has identified the West Brom striker as the man he wants to add goals to his misfiring forward line.
And Rodgers is pushing for a deal to happen when the transfer window reopens in six weeks.

 Berahino could cost in-excess of £15million, while the Baggies will look to keep the striker by offering him an improved contract.

Having spent close to £120million on new talent in the summer, though that was offset by the £75million sale of Luis Suarez, there is doubt over whether Rodgers will be afforded the funds to launch a raid for Berahino.

And if a deal is not possible in January, then Rodgers is expected to return for Berahino in the summer.
